Before Ms. Thatcher was all that she was a graduate from Oxford with a degree in chemistry and tasked with figuring out a way to whip extra air into ice cream. Her work resulted in what we know as soft serve today. It was first served from Mr. Whippy trucks in Great Britain before it spread around the world.
